Surgical Challenges of Familial Hypercholesterolemia

Insights

Familial hypercholesterolemia patients can develop angina from left internal mammary artery stenosis and aortic stenosis. Surgical intervention involving artery repair and aortic valve replacement successfully treated the patient.

Area of Science:

  • Cardiovascular Surgery
  • Interventional Cardiology
  • Medical Genetics

Background:

  • Familial hypercholesterolemia (FH) is a genetic disorder causing high cholesterol and premature cardiovascular disease.
  • Coronary revascularization is a common treatment for FH-related coronary artery disease.
  • Complications can arise years after revascularization, including graft stenosis and valvular heart disease.

Observation:

  • A 21-year-old FH patient presented with angina 9 years post-coronary revascularization.
  • The patient had ostial stenosis of the left internal mammary artery (LIMA) and severe calcific aortic stenosis with a small aortic root.
  • This dual pathology led to angina and impaired left ventricular function.

Findings:

  • Surgical enlargement of the LIMA ostium using a saphenous vein patch improved left ventricular function.
  • Successful aortic valve replacement (AVR) with posterior aortic root enlargement was performed.
  • The combined surgical approach effectively managed the complex cardiovascular issues.

Implications:

  • This case highlights the importance of monitoring FH patients long-term after revascularization.
  • Surgical techniques for LIMA ostial stenosis and aortic root reconstruction are crucial.
  • Aggressive management can improve outcomes in complex cardiovascular cases in young adults.

Cholesterol: Significance and Regulation

Although not a source of energy, cholesterol plays a significant role as a foundational structure for bile salts, steroid hormones, and vitamin D, as well as being a crucial component of plasma membranes. Approximately 15% of blood cholesterol is derived from our diet, with the remainder synthesized from acetyl CoA by the liver and intestines. Cholesterol is eliminated from the body through its conversion into bile salts, which are eventually discarded in the feces.
